DESCRIPTION
Working under the supervision of the principal or assistant principal, with supervision and guidance from the Title I Office, the Family Involvement Contact provides assistance and support to Title I teachers to establish home-school partnerships and school-based family involvement. The position communicates effectively with families about school programs, activities, and academic resources. The position also serves on the Family Involvement Team and attends family programming events.
ESSENTIAL POSITION RESPONSIBILITIES
Possess an awareness of the vision/mission/goals of the Howard County Public School System
Possess an awareness of the Howard County Parent, Family, and Community Involvement Policy
Actively support and facilitate home-school communication and participation in school programs
Communicate and collaborate with Title I school staff and central office personnel to exchange information on current programs and services that support students and their families
Plan involvement activities with family input
Serve as a member of the Family Involvement Team and/or School Improvement Team
Recruit Title I family members to participate on school-based committees
